Kentwood’s Yang takes vault title, finishes fourth in the all-around at 4A state gymnastics championships

Kentwood’s Ashley Yang captured the individual vault title and finished fourth in the all-around competition at the 4A state gymnastics championships at Sammamish High School in Belleuve last weekend.

Yang posted a score of 9.625 to take the vault win last Saturday. She was sixth in the floor exercise (9.6).

Yang scored 37.250 in last Friday’s all-around chase on the strength of a second-place performance on the vault (.525), a third-place finish on the floor (9.6) and a 10th-place effort on the beam (9.2).

Camas’ Shea McGee took the all-around title (38.175), leading her squad to the team championship.

Kentlake’s Cecelia Loudermilk was seventh in the all-around.

In the individual event finals last Saturday, Loudermilk was third on the vault (9.500) and fifth on the bars (9.350).
